About The First 48: Missing Persons

The First 48: Missing Persons is an American documentary television series on A&E.

The series debuted on June 2, 2011, with the second season premiering on March 15, 2012.

Lost Anniversary/Checked Out

Barbara Naklicki holds off a full two days before reporting the disappearance of her husband, Ed. The first clue is a dire one: Ed's work van has been found in a forest preserve on the city's edge. Next, Detective Bob Berent gets a strange phone call from a hotel on Michigan Avenue, Chicago's main shopping drag. The hotel reports a guest took a room three nights ago--and vanished.
